What the Window Regulator Actually Does

The window regulator is the mechanism inside the door that raises and lowers the glass when you press the switch. It is the muscle and the guide rail of the system. The glass itself does not float freely; it is anchored to the regulator and travels along a defined track every time it moves up or down.

How the Regulator Connects to the Glass

On most modern luxury vehicles, including the Purosangue, the regulator uses a motor that drives the glass through a cable-and-pulley or scissor-style arm system. The bottom edge of the glass is fastened to one or more carriers, sometimes called shoes or clamps, that ride along guide channels. As the motor turns, those carriers pull the glass up or push it down in a smooth, controlled arc. The glass and the regulator effectively move as one assembly.

Because the Purosangue places a premium on quiet operation and a flush, refined seal, the regulator has to deliver the glass into the surrounding weatherstripping at precisely the right angle and speed. The system is engineered so the pane seats cleanly against the seals, supports cabin acoustics, and avoids wind noise at speed. That precision is exactly why even small disruptions to the mechanism can become noticeable problems.

The Electronics Layer

Beyond the mechanical parts, the regulator system often coordinates with door electronics: auto-up and auto-down functions, pinch protection that stops the glass if it senses an obstruction, and on frameless designs, a slight automatic drop of the glass when you open the door so it can clear the seal. These features depend on the motor, the position sensors, and the glass all behaving predictably. When the glass-to-regulator relationship is disturbed, these conveniences can misbehave or stop working entirely.

How a Shatter Event Can Damage the Regulator

Here is the part that surprises most owners: the same impact that breaks the glass can also bend, jam, or knock the regulator out of alignment. People tend to assume the glass simply broke and everything behind it is fine. Sometimes that's true. Often it isn't.

The Physics of a Break

Tempered side glass is designed to shatter into thousands of small pebbled pieces when it fails. That's a safety feature. But the force that causes the break — a flung rock on a highway, a tool used in a break-in, a door slammed against an object, or a low-speed impact — transfers energy into the door, not just the glass. That energy doesn't politely stop at the surface. It travels into the carriers holding the glass and into the regulator arms and tracks behind them.

When the glass shatters, the carriers that were gripping it suddenly lose their load. If the impact was forceful or angled, those carriers can be pushed out of position, the guide channel can be tweaked, or a regulator arm can bow slightly. In a break-in scenario, prying tools are sometimes wedged into the door to force the glass or the lock, and that direct leverage can deform the mechanism even more than the impact that broke the glass.

Debris in the Mechanism

There's a second, quieter way a shatter event damages the regulator: the glass itself. When tempered glass breaks, a large amount of small fragments falls down inside the door cavity, settling directly into the tracks and around the moving parts of the regulator. Those fragments can wedge into the guide channels and against the carriers. Even if the regulator wasn't bent by the impact, running it with glass debris packed into the tracks can grind, bind, and accelerate wear. This is one reason a thorough door clean-out is part of doing the job properly, not an optional extra.

Frameless and Flush-Glass Considerations

The Purosangue's door design emphasizes a clean, integrated look, and that often means the glass behavior is tightly choreographed with the door and seal. Designs that rely on precise glass positioning are less forgiving of a regulator that's even slightly off. A pane that used to seat perfectly may now sit a hair proud of the seal, whistle at speed, or refuse to complete its auto-up travel — all symptoms that trace back to the mechanism rather than the glass alone.

Signs the Regulator May Be Damaged, Not Just the Glass

If your glass is already shattered, you may not be able to test everything yourself, but there are clear indicators a trained eye looks for. Understanding these helps the conversation make sense when a technician explains the recommendation.

  • Glass that won't move smoothly: Before the break, the window glided up and down. If the remaining glass or a test of the mechanism shows hesitation, stuttering, or uneven speed, the regulator may be binding.
  • Off-track or crooked travel: If the glass tilts, racks to one side, or appears to climb at an angle instead of straight up, a carrier or guide channel has likely shifted.
  • Grinding, clicking, or rattling noise: A healthy regulator is nearly silent. Grinding usually means glass debris in the tracks or a damaged gear; clicking or rattling can point to a loose carrier or a motor straining against a jam.
  • The motor runs but the glass doesn't respond: If you hear the motor working but the glass moves little or not at all, the connection between the motor and the glass carrier may be compromised.
  • The glass won't seat or seal fully: A pane that stops short, sits unevenly against the weatherstrip, or lets in wind noise after a fresh install can indicate the regulator isn't delivering it to the right final position.

Any one of these on its own warrants a closer look. Several together strongly suggest the regulator needs attention alongside the glass. Why Identifying Regulator Damage Before Ordering Glass Matters

This is the practical heart of the issue. Catching regulator damage during the initial inspection — rather than after a new pane is already installed — is the difference between one clean visit and a frustrating return trip.

The Return-Appointment Problem

Imagine the glass gets replaced, but the regulator was quietly bent in the same event. The new pane goes in, but it binds, travels crooked, or grinds against debris in the track. Now the new glass is stressed by a mechanism that can't move it properly, the window may not seal correctly, and another appointment is needed to address the regulator — possibly even risking the brand-new glass during a second teardown. That's wasted time, added hassle, and exactly what a careful inspection is meant to prevent.

Ordering the Right Parts the First Time

For a vehicle like the Purosangue, parts are specific and sourced with care. We use OEM-quality glass and materials matched to your door's exact configuration, including any acoustic layering, tint, or sensor accommodations the original pane carried. If the regulator also needs replacement, identifying that up front means the correct mechanism is sourced alongside the glass, so everything arrives together and the job is completed in a single, well-planned visit. Discovering a regulator issue after the fact means starting a second sourcing cycle and scheduling all over again.

Protecting the New Glass

A fresh pane installed into a compromised mechanism is a pane at risk. A binding regulator puts uneven stress on the glass edges, and debris in the tracks can chip or scratch a new pane as it travels. By confirming the regulator is sound — or replacing it when it isn't — we protect the investment you're making in new glass and ensure smooth, quiet operation from the first time you press the switch.

How Our Mobile Inspection Approaches the Door

Because we come to you anywhere across Arizona and Florida, the inspection happens wherever your Purosangue is — your driveway, a parking garage at work, or another safe location. Here's the general sequence our technicians follow to determine whether you're dealing with glass alone or glass plus regulator.

  1. Assess the visible damage and the break pattern. The way the glass shattered and where the impact landed offers early clues about whether force traveled into the mechanism.
  2. Inspect the door interior and cavity. We look inside the door for fallen glass fragments, check the carriers and guide channels, and examine the regulator arms for any bending or displacement.
  3. Test the mechanism's travel where possible. If the regulator can be safely operated, we watch for crooked movement, hesitation, grinding, or a motor that runs without moving the glass properly.
  4. Check the seals and final seating point. We confirm the path the glass needs to follow to seat cleanly against the weatherstripping, since a regulator that delivers the pane to the wrong spot causes wind noise and leaks.
  5. Confirm the parts list before ordering. Only after this review do we finalize whether the job is glass alone or glass plus regulator, so the correct OEM-quality components are sourced together.

This methodical approach is what lets us plan the visit accurately. When everything needed is identified before parts are ordered, the actual replacement is efficient — a typical door glass replacement takes roughly 30 to 45 minutes of work, plus around an hour of safe handling and settling time so seals and any adhesive points set properly. When a regulator is part of the job, we account for that in the plan so you're not surprised on the day.
